区块链是一种分布式数据库技术,其主要特点是数据的不可篡改性和透明性。通过去中心化的网络结构,区块链能够以安全、高效的方式存储和传递信息。最早起源于比特币,区块链的基本构造在于将数据按“块”形式组织,并通过加密算法将其链式连接起来,从而形成一个持续增长的数据链条。
区块链的核心由多个“块”组成,每个块包含了特定的数据、一个时间戳和前一个块的哈希值。哈希值是一种将任意长度的输入数据转换为固定长度的字符串的密码学算法,这使得每个块都能与前一个块形成不可分割的链条。这样,如果有人试图篡改某个块中的数据,后续所有块的哈希值也会随之改变,立刻可以被网络中的节点识别出。
此外,区块链技术利用分布式网络,所有参与的节点都有一份完整的账本,当有新的交易发生时,所有节点会共同确认并记录这笔交易。这种共识机制保证了数据的真实性和一致性,并且减少了单点故障的风险。
区块链依赖于多种加密技术来保护数据的安全性和隐私性。其中,最重要的有两种:哈希函数和公私钥加密。哈希函数能够将数据生成固定长度的加密字符串,使得任何微小的变化都会显著改变输出结果,确保了数据的一致性和完整性。公私钥加密则允许用户生成一对密钥,用于加密和解密交易,确保信息只被授权的用户接收和访问。
随着技术的不断发展,区块链的应用场景已经从最初的数字货币扩展到金融、供应链管理、医疗健康、身份验证、数字版权等多个领域。区块链能够为各个行业带来透明度、安全性和效率,而这些优势使得越来越多的企业和组织开始探索区块链的潜力,寻找适合自己业务模型的应用解决方案。
在深入了解区块链技术后,以下是五个相关问题,其内容将作详细阐述:
区块链的工作原理可以简要描述为信息的记录、传播和验证深入结合的过程。用户提出交易请求后,这一请求会被网络中的节点接收并转化为数据。“块”的生成和验证过程包括多个步骤:
首先,用户发起的交易会被打包成一个候选块。接下来,网络中各个节点将会共同参与对这个候选块的验证。具体的验证方法通常依赖共识机制,如工作量证明(PoW)或权益证明(PoS),目的是确保该交易的合法性以及用户的身份确认。
验证通过后,该候选块会被添加到已有区块链末尾,形成新的数据块链,完成信息的存储和更新。此外,网络中每个节点都会收到更新后的账本,确保所有节点的一致性。
在此过程中,区块链技术通过使用密码学算法和分布式网络架构,确保数据不易篡改且高效可信。
区块链的主要特性包括:
区块链技术在各个行业都有广泛的应用案例,以下是几个典型示例:
区块链的安全性体现在技术架构和运行机制中。首先,由于采用分布式存储,每一个节点都存有账本副本,且一旦数据写入,就无法被篡改,黑客即便获得某个节点的控制权,也无法对整个网络造成影响。
其次,区块链技术利用了先进的密码学算法,例如哈希算法保证块间的链接和数据完整性;而公私钥加密则确保了数据传输过程中的机密性,只有持有私钥的人才能进行解密和交易。
此外,通过建立共识机制,确保网络节点在交易验证过程中的一致性,降低了双花攻击的可能性。最终,随着技术的不断迭代和完善,区块链的安全性也在持续强化。
未来,区块链将会向更加多元化和智能化的方向发展。以下是一些可能的重要趋势:
综上所述,区块链不仅是一种颠覆传统的创新技术,更是改变许多行业现状的动力。了解区块链的构建原理和应用前景,有助于我们更好地把握未来的发展机会。
2003-2026 metamask下载app @版权所有 |网站地图|桂ICP备2022008651号-1